'The Fleet's In' is a 1928 American silent comedy film directed by Malcolm St. Clair and written by Monte Brice, George Marion Jr., and J. Walter Ruben. The film stars Clara Bow, James Hall, Jack Oakie, Bodil Rosing, Eddie Dunn, and Jean Laverty. The film was released on September 15, 1928, by Paramount Pictures.

Survival status



'The Fleet's In' is presumed to be a lost film.[http://www.silentera.com/PSFL/data/F/FleetsIn1928.html Progressive Silent Film List: 'The Fleet's In'] at silentera.com
